1. Germ Theory of Infectious Diseases

The germ theory of infectious diseases directly challenged the medieval conviction that “The Black Death Caused By God’s Wrath.” For centuries, plague was framed as punishment, not pathology, so the idea that invisible organisms caused it sounded almost blasphemous. Modern microbiology now shows that the bubonic plague is driven by the bacterium Yersinia pestis, carried by fleas and rodents, not divine anger described in lists of spectacularly wrong ideas about disease such as Black Death.

Once germ theory gained traction, it transformed public health. Quarantine, sanitation, and vector control became rational tools rather than desperate rituals. The stakes were enormous: understanding that bacteria and viruses spread through contact, droplets, and contaminated water allowed cities to redesign sewers, hospitals to sterilize instruments, and governments to track outbreaks. What began as a wild claim that tiny “germs” caused mass death is now the foundation of infection control, antibiotic therapy, and global surveillance systems that try to prevent the next pandemic.

2. Viral Causation of Illnesses

The recognition that viruses cause specific illnesses overturned moralistic theories such as “Smallpox Caused By Sin.” Early communities saw smallpox scars as marks of spiritual failure, so the proposal that a submicroscopic agent, the variola virus, was responsible sounded speculative and even offensive. Laboratory work eventually isolated variola, proving that infection, not immorality, drove the disease and that immunity could be induced through vaccination rather than repentance.

This shift had world-changing consequences. Once scientists accepted that a virus, not sin, caused smallpox, coordinated vaccination campaigns could be justified as a technical solution instead of a theological intrusion. The eradication of smallpox stands as a proof of concept that understanding viral causation lets societies move from fatalism to prevention. It also set the template for tackling other viral threats, from polio to measles, by focusing on immunization, surveillance, and evidence-based risk communication instead of blame.

3. Bacterial and Genetic Factors in Chronic Diseases

Leprosy illustrates how bacterial and genetic explanations displaced supernatural thinking. For generations, “Leprosy Caused By A Curse From God” framed sufferers as morally tainted, justifying isolation and stigma. The claim that a specific bacterium, Mycobacterium leprae, caused the disease was initially controversial, because it implied that a curse could be cultured, stained, and treated. As microbiologists identified the organism and traced its transmission, the curse narrative collapsed.

Modern research also shows that host genetics influence who develops clinical leprosy after exposure, adding nuance to the bacterial story. The combination of microbial and genetic evidence turned a supposed divine punishment into a chronic infection that responds to multidrug antibiotic therapy. That reclassification matters for policy and ethics: people once banished to colonies can now receive outpatient care, and public health messaging can focus on early diagnosis and treatment rather than fear of contamination by the “cursed.”

4. Oncogenic Viruses and Lifestyle Risks in Cancer

Cancer theory has undergone a similar reversal. For a long time, some physicians insisted that “Cancer Caused By Too Much Sex,” folding tumors into a moral panic about promiscuity. When researchers proposed that specific infections, such as human papillomavirus, and environmental exposures contributed to malignancy, critics dismissed these ideas as speculative. Evidence that oncogenic HPV strains integrate into host DNA and drive cervical and other cancers eventually forced a rewrite of textbooks.

Today, the recognition that viruses, tobacco smoke, ultraviolet radiation, and inherited mutations all raise cancer risk underpins screening and vaccination programs. The HPV vaccine, for example, targets viral strains known to cause malignancy, reframing prevention as a matter of immunization rather than sexual policing. By replacing the simplistic “too much sex” narrative with a multifactorial model, science opened the door to targeted therapies, risk stratification, and public campaigns that emphasize informed choice instead of shame.

6. Metabolic and Genetic Contributors to Obesity

Obesity theory has swung between moral judgment and crude biology. At one point, some doctors insisted “Obesity Caused By Glands,” treating every larger body as evidence of a single malfunctioning organ. When researchers proposed more complex metabolic and genetic models, including leptin resistance and variations in energy expenditure, critics accused them of making excuses. Over time, detailed studies of hormones, appetite regulation, and adipose tissue biology showed that weight is governed by intricate feedback loops, not a single rogue gland.

That does not mean environment and diet are irrelevant, but it does mean that simplistic glandular or moral explanations fail. Recognizing the roles of genetics, endocrine signaling, and social determinants reframes obesity as a chronic, multifactorial condition. For policymakers and clinicians, this shift has practical stakes: it supports comprehensive strategies that combine nutrition, physical activity, medication, and sometimes surgery, instead of shaming individuals or prescribing one-size-fits-all “fix your glands” cures that never matched the evidence.

7. Sexual Orientation as a Natural Variation

The idea that sexual orientation is a natural human variation once sounded radical in a medical culture that insisted “Homosexuality Is A Disease.” Early psychiatrists classified same-sex attraction as pathology, and any suggestion that it might be an innate, non-disordered trait met fierce resistance. As biological, psychological, and sociological research accumulated, the disease model became impossible to defend, and major diagnostic manuals removed homosexuality from their lists of mental disorders.

Viewing sexual orientation as part of a normal spectrum has profound implications. It delegitimizes “conversion” practices that tried to cure what was never an illness and supports legal protections grounded in the understanding that orientation is not a voluntary vice. For individuals, this scientific reframing can reduce internalized stigma and improve mental health outcomes. For institutions, it demands that policies, from healthcare protocols to school curricula, respect sexual diversity rather than treat it as a defect to be corrected.

8. Brain Lateralization in Handedness

Left-handedness offers a quieter but telling example of a once-mocked theory becoming mainstream. For centuries, some educators and physicians treated “Left-Handedness Is A Disease,” forcing children to switch hands and warning parents of supposed cognitive problems. The claim that handedness reflected normal brain lateralization, with hemispheric specialization producing a left-hand preference in a minority of people, initially sounded speculative to those steeped in right-handed norms.

Neuroscience has since confirmed that about 10 percent of people are naturally left-handed, with differences in motor cortex organization rather than pathology. This recognition matters for design and safety, from scissors and desks to industrial controls that once ignored left-handed users. It also illustrates a broader pattern: when science validates natural variation, practices built on pathologizing difference, such as forced hand-switching or educational punishment, lose their justification and gradually fade.

9. Psychological and Hormonal Bases of Hysteria

The abandonment of “Female Hysteria Caused By A Wandering Womb” shows how anatomy-based myths can crumble under psychological and hormonal evidence. Ancient physicians literally imagined the uterus roaming the body, causing choking, mood swings, and paralysis. Later, when some doctors suggested that stress, trauma, and neurotransmitter imbalances might explain these symptoms, their ideas clashed with centuries of entrenched folklore about female bodies.

Modern psychiatry now interprets many historical “hysteria” cases as anxiety disorders, depression, or conversion disorders, shaped by social pressures and neurobiology rather than a migrating organ. Hormonal research adds further nuance, showing how fluctuations in estrogen and progesterone can influence mood without turning women into perpetual patients. The stakes are high: discarding the wandering womb myth helped dismantle medical justifications for confining women, prescribing unnecessary surgeries, or dismissing their complaints as inherent female instability.

10. Chemical and Physical Processes in Rare Burns

Finally, the debate over “Spontaneous Human Combustion” highlights how mundane physics can replace supernatural speculation. Grisly reports of bodies found burned in otherwise intact rooms fueled the belief that people could ignite from within. When investigators proposed the “wick effect,” in which an external flame ignites clothing and body fat that then burns slowly like a candle, skeptics mocked it as an ad hoc explanation.

Experiments and forensic reconstructions have since shown that the wick effect can produce the selective, intense burns seen in alleged spontaneous cases, without invoking mysterious internal fires. Recognizing this mechanism shifts responsibility toward fire safety, alcohol use, and mobility issues that can leave victims unable to escape small ignition sources.
